Subject: SDK parity before Thursday's sync

Hi Renna,

Quick heads-up before the eng sync: the Kestrel SDK is still missing batched uploads and offline retry, both of which shipped in the Plover SDK last month. On-call gets pinged about this weekly. The full parity matrix and target dates are tracked on our internal page.

operations page: https://confluence.tolvaqsys.corp/spaces/pages/pages/6e787158f507

## Further Reading

The Larkspur pricing experiment varied ticket tiers for the Foxglove Arena pilot across three cohorts between Q2 and Q3. Most of the modeling assumptions live in the analysis notebooks bundled under `experiments/larkspur`, and the holdout methodology is documented inline. Before extending or rerunning the experiment, read the guardrail rules — several price floors are contractual and must not be altered. Decisions from the final readout, including why cohort C was discarded, are summarized on the internal wiki page below.

runbook for badug-kadup: https://confluence.zemvarlabs.internal/projects/browse/display/projects/bd1b

## Quartex Environments

Quartex replaced its homegrown job queue with Brindlehook workers in release 9. Plugin authors: stop polling the legacy `/jobs` endpoint; it now returns 410. Enqueue via the worker API instead. Staging and production run identical worker pools; sandbox runs a single worker. The active configuration values for the sandbox environment are listed below.

deployment values, yadug-bawif:
[framir]
team = pelox
access_code = ac_a38ab2
owner = tamion.julael
host = framir.tolvaqlabs.test
port = 11211
peer = tammir.zemvargrid.local
salt = 2215ef03
pin = 1541

Leadership Review Briefing — Annual Billing Transition

Prepared for the sales leads ahead of the Keldora leadership review. We propose moving Sombrell Platform customers from monthly to annual billing over two cycles, with a 10% incentive for early converters. Forecast models from the Ashvale pilot show improved retention and smoother cash flow, though churn risk among small accounts requires careful handling. The underlying plan is summarised in the confidential note below.

confidential, kagep-kahof: Druokax Systems plans to lower the Ulaath list price by 53 percent in March.